As our IT Manager, you will play a pivotal role in ensuring the efficiency, security, and reliability of our systems. Working closely with our IT Director, Operations Partner, and the wider operations and systems team, you will help shape and implement strategic IT initiatives that support seamless business operations across the firm.
This role is crucial for our firm\βs ambitious growth plans, aiming to double in size over the next five years. By working closely with senior leadership and department heads, you will enhance IT efficiency and security to support the company\βs growth objectives, so if you want to make a significant impact in a dynamic company, this is the perfect opportunity for you
This position is ideal for a proactive IT Manager who has experience in a similar role. The successful candidate will have the full backing and support of PKF Infuse, our IT support group company, and a UK Top 10 MSP.
The ideal candidate should have excellent knowledge of the full O365 and MS suite of products, be a strong communicator, and possess the ability to hit the ground running.
This role will require travel to our other offices and occasional out-of-hours ad hoc work.
The Important Work You Will Be Doing
-
IT Strategy & Planning
-
Work with our IT Director to develop and implement the firm\βs IT strategy
- Lead digital transformation initiatives and identify opportunities for innovation
-
Lead IT projects such as system upgrades, migrations, and new technology rollouts
-
Infrastructure & Systems Management
-
Manage and maintain all internal IT systems, including networks, servers, cloud services, and business applications.
- Ensure system security, data integrity, and compliance with relevant regulations (e.g., GDPR)
-
Manage relationships with external IT providers and software vendors
-
Risk & Compliance
-
Play a key part in monitoring our cybersecurity protocols and disaster recovery plans
- Ensure compliance with internal policies and external regulatory requirements, including but not limited to GDPR and ISO 27001

PKF International
As an active member of PKF International, we are part of a large global network of legally independent accounting firms.
Located in the 5 fastest growing global markets, we have ground presence in 150 countries and span across many jurisdictions.
An ambitious, future-focused network, PKF provides a comprehensive range of services. Operating in unison with member firms across the world, we are able to share our ideas, expertise, and specialist resources to better serve our clients, delivering highly personalised services and global connectivity through our client-centric culture.
